Description

A Flourishing Business Model Approach

  • Does it make sense to build our urban worlds and future societies by achieving one political issue at a time?

  • Why can’t we move or collective thinking and action beyond single-issue social action?

  • How might we design civic business models for our cities and society?

A significant design challenge of our time is anticipating the relationships of multiple environmental and social problems as a complex system of nonlinear relationships. However, we cannot think about, model or discuss the relationships well, especially in the heat of discussion with deliberative groups and decision making processes. We need not only better engagement and dialogue processes for citizen deliberative problem solving, we require relevant tools.

In February’s Design with Dialogue Peter Jones workshops a tool for building civic design proposals, based on the Flourishing Business Canvas for strongly sustainable business models.

This visual model enables a participatory mapping of propositions, values, and preferences that might yield significantly better group decisions for sociocultural and ecological development and governance in any planning engagement.
